Understanding Free Netflix Username

What Does Free Netflix Username Mean?

A free Netflix username refers to an account that has been shared or obtained without the owner's consent. These accounts are often leaked online or traded between individuals. While it might seem like a way to save money, using such accounts can lead to significant issues, including account suspension and potential legal action.

Netflix has strict policies against sharing accounts beyond the authorized devices and users. When you use a free username, you risk violating these terms, which could result in your access being cut off or even legal repercussions if traced back to you.

Risks of Using Free Netflix Username

Legal Consequences of Using Free Accounts

Using a free Netflix username without permission can lead to legal consequences. Netflix operates under copyright laws, and unauthorized sharing or use of accounts violates these regulations. In some cases, individuals have faced lawsuits or fines for misusing subscriptions.

Moreover, sharing or using leaked credentials can expose you to cybercriminals who exploit such information for malicious purposes. Always consider the legal implications before accessing any free streaming service.

Security Risks Involved

One of the most significant risks of using a free Netflix username is the potential compromise of your personal data. Many of these accounts are obtained through phishing scams or data breaches. By entering your information on unsecured platforms, you may inadvertently expose yourself to hackers.

Additionally, using a leaked account can lead to malware infections or phishing attempts. Cybercriminals often create fake login pages to steal sensitive information, including credit card details and personal identifiers.

Where Do Free Netflix Usernames Come From?

Leaked Credentials and Data Breaches

Many free Netflix usernames originate from data breaches where hackers compromise legitimate accounts. These credentials are then sold on the dark web or shared freely online. While it might seem tempting to use such accounts, doing so supports illegal activities and puts you at risk.

Data breaches occur when cybercriminals exploit vulnerabilities in systems to gain unauthorized access to databases. Always ensure that you use strong, unique passwords and enable two-factor authentication to protect your accounts from breaches.

Sharing and Trading Accounts

Another common source of free Netflix usernames is account sharing or trading. Some users willingly share their credentials with friends or family, while others trade accounts for mutual benefit. However, this practice violates Netflix's terms of service and can result in account termination.

Protecting Yourself from Scams

Identifying Phishing Scams

Phishing scams are a common threat associated with free Netflix usernames. Scammers create fake login pages that mimic Netflix's official site, tricking users into entering their credentials. To avoid falling victim to such scams, always verify the URL before entering any personal information.

  • Check the URL for official domain names.
  • Avoid clicking on suspicious links or pop-ups.
  • Use antivirus software and firewalls to detect malicious sites.

Netflix's Policies on Account Sharing

Terms of Service and Account Sharing Rules

Netflix's terms of service explicitly prohibit sharing accounts beyond authorized users. Each subscription allows access on a limited number of devices simultaneously, depending on the plan. Exceeding this limit or sharing credentials with unauthorized individuals violates these terms.

Violations can result in account suspension, termination, or other penalties. Always review Netflix's policies to ensure compliance and avoid any potential issues.

Enforcement of Account Sharing Rules

Netflix actively enforces its account sharing rules by monitoring usage patterns and restricting access when violations are detected. The platform may require users to verify their accounts or limit device access to ensure compliance with its policies.

Other Streaming Services

Several streaming services offer free or ad-supported tiers that provide access to a wide range of content. Platforms like Tubi, Crackle, and Pluto TV offer legitimate alternatives to Netflix without requiring a paid subscription. While the content selection may differ, these services can satisfy your entertainment needs at no cost.
